Examine for Entrance Information



To begin rodent-proofing your attic room, examine for entry factors. Beginning by very carefully examining the outside of your home, seeking any openings that rodents might utilize to access to your attic. Look for voids around utility lines, vents, and pipes, in addition to any type of cracks or openings in the foundation or exterior siding. See to it to pay very close attention to locations where different building materials fulfill, as these are common entry points for rats.

Inside the attic, search for indications of existing rodent task such as droppings, ate wires, or nesting products. Make use of a flashlight to thoroughly inspect dark edges and concealed spaces.

Seal Cracks and Gaps



Inspect your attic extensively for any fractures and gaps that require to be sealed to prevent rodents from getting in. Rodents can press with also the tiniest openings, so it's vital to secure any type of prospective access points. Examine around pipes, vents, cords, and where the walls fulfill the roofing. Make use of a mix of steel wool and caulking to seal off these openings efficiently. Steel wool is a superb deterrent as rats can not eat through it. Ensure that all gaps are snugly sealed to deny accessibility to unwanted bugs.

Don't overlook the significance of sealing gaps around windows and doors too. Use climate stripping or door sweeps to secure these locations effectively. Inspect the locations where energy lines go into the attic room and secure them off making use of a suitable sealer. By making the effort to seal all splits and gaps in your attic room, you produce an obstacle that rodents will locate tough to violation.
